### Problem Description

I am experiencing an issue where a loaded family containing voids that are intended to cut concrete elements leaves behind triangular artifacts in the IFC export (see attached image).
I have tried splitting the family so that rectangular and circular voids do not cut the object in the same operation, and I have also converted the circular voids into polygons. This has reduced the problem (I have several hundred instances of these concrete elements with doors along a tunnel), but it has not eliminated it completely.
I have tested several combinations of export settings under the Advanced IFC export options without any change. The only solution that mostly removes the issue is setting the Level of Detail to Extra Low, but in that case all circular geometry is converted into polygons, which is not acceptable for delivery to our client.
The locations of the openings are fixed and cannot be moved.
We are using IFC 2x3 Coordination View 2.0 and Revit IFC Add-on version 25.4.50.6.
What other options are available to resolve this issue?
